City Overview
As of 2009, Springville's population is 26,864 people. Since 2000, it has had a population growth of 27.29 percent.
The median home cost in Springville is $184,740. Home appreciation the last year has been -8.90 percent.
Compared to the rest of the country, Springville's cost of living is 6.23% Lower than the U.S. average.
Springville public schools spend $3,570 per student. The average school expenditure in the U.S. is $6,058. There are about 24 students per teacher in Springville.
The unemployment rate in Springville is 5.10 percent(U.S. avg. is 8.50%). Recent job growth is Negative. Springville jobs have Decreased by 3.90 percent.

People
The 2009 Springville, UT, population is 26,864. There are 2,254 people per square mile (population density).
Family in Springville, UT
The median age is 26.5. The US median is 37.6. 69.00% of people in Springville, UT, are married. 5.27% are divorced.
The average household size is 3.41 people. 44.25% of people are married, with children. 6.54% have children, but are single.
Race in Springville, UT
92.54% of people are white, 0.11% are black, 0.71% are asian, 0.68% are native american, and 5.04% claim 'Other'.
5.75% of the people in Springville, UT, claim hispanic ethnicity (meaning 94.25% are non-hispanic).

Health
There are 133 physicians per 100,000 population in Springville, UT. The US average is 170.
Springville, UT Health Index
Air quality in Springville, UT is 28 on a scale to 100 (higher is better). This is based on ozone alert days and number of pollutants in the air, as reported by the EPA.
Water quality in Springville, UT is 52 on a scale to 100 (higher is better). The EPA has a complex method of measuring watershed quality using 15 indicators.
Superfund index is 90 on a scale to 100 (higher is better). This is upon the number and impact of EPA Superfund pollution sites in the county, including spending on the cleanup efforts.

The unemployment rate in Springville, UT, is 5.10%, with job growth of -3.90%. Future job growth over the next ten years is predicted to be 27.20%.
Springville, UT Taxes
Springville, UT,sales tax rate is 6.25%. Income tax is 7.00%.
Springville, UT Income and Salaries
The income per capita is $17,589, which includes all adults and children. The median household income is $53,066.

Crime
Springville, UT, violent crime, on a scale from 1 (low crime) to 10, is 4. Violent crime is composed of four offenses: murder and nonnegligent manslaughter, forcible rape, robbery, and aggravated assault. The US average is 3.
Springville, UT, property crime, on a scale from 1 (low) to 10, is 6. Property crime includes the offenses of burglary, larceny-theft, motor vehicle theft, and arson. The object of the theft-type offenses is the taking of money or property, but there is no force or threat of force against the victims. The US average is 3.

Climate
Springville, UT, gets 12 inches of rain per year. The US average is 37. Snowfall is 14 inches. The average US city gets 25 inches of snow per year. The number of days with any measurable precipitation is 65.
On average, there are 225 sunny days per year in Springville, UT. The July high is around 92 degrees. The January low is 16. Our comfort index, which is based on humidity during the hot months, is a 66 out of 100, where higher is more comfortable. The US average on the comfort index is 44.

Education
Springville, UT, schools spend $3,570 per student. There are 24 pupils per teacher, 1,004 students per librarian, and 805 children per counselor in Springville, UT schools.

Transportation
The average one-way commute in Springville, UT, takes 22 minutes. 79% of commuters drive their own car alone. 13% carpool with others. 1% take mass transit and 4% work from home.

Voting
11.64% of the people in Springville, UT are registered as Democrats. 85.99% are registered Republican. Remaining are independent: 2.38%.
